About the role… The Renewal Sales Director will partner with Sales and Customer Success to drive conceptualization and implementation of renewal strategies and secure sustainable renewal pipeline. The ideal candidate will have proven execution of building and leading a renewal sales team, partnering with multiple Sales leaders to develop the renewal strategy and key processes. Renewals are the lifeblood of a company’s revenue stream, and the Renewals leader must be able to both focus on the achievement of Renewals targets while keeping a strong teaming approach in their engagement with Sales leadership.

In this role you can expect to…

  • Partner closely with Geo leaders on continually refining our Renewals strategy/process and engagement with Sales & Customer Success.
  • Ensure that Renewal policies, procedures and processes are understood and implemented consistently and cross-functionally.
  • Follow Corporate guidelines and forecast current / future quarter renewal opportunities accurately and on a weekly basis.
  • Partner with Sales leadership to ensure alignment in our go‑to‑market for Sales/Renewals.
  • Become an expert in Sprinklr products and solutions, often re‑selling the value and identifying future expansion opportunities.
  • Provide role clarity for team members and link departmental goals to the larger organization and Corp Initiatives.
  • Create and deliver summaries of key performance metrics that help the Sales organization focus on Renewals execution & expansion, our customer’s success and account planning for the Renewal.
  • Engage with field operations to establish effective analysis of trends and performance in order to continually identify greater efficiencies and achieve operational excellence.
  • Work closely with our Channels teams to drive growth and expansion via our partners.
  • Assist Sales, Renewals reps and/or leadership with Renewals negotiations & strategic discussions.
  • Lead cross‑functional initiatives in support of Renewals, collaborating closely with Sales, Operations, Customer Success and Finance.

You may be a good fit for our team if you have…

  • 10+ years of progressive Leadership experience in Renewals, Sales and/or Customer Success, preferably in a SaaS environment.
  • 3+ years success leading a team of individual contributors and/or other managers.
  • Strong executive presence and ability to closely partner with multiple layers of the organization.
  • Strong financial/analytical background who is sales driven with a growth mindset.
  • Experience scaling teams in a hyper‑growth environment.
  • Ability to adapt and plan on the fly and deliver on both the customer and organizational needs.
  • Strong communication (both written and oral), negotiation, and presentation skills.
  • Demonstrated focus on execution towards desired outcomes with a track record of success under pressure.
  • Experience creating employee‑focused programs to drive engagement.
  • A strong understanding of enterprise software selling processes.
